The data center industry across the MENAT region is evolving quickly, driven by the rising need for high-performance, energy-efficient, and resilient digital infrastructure. Large investments, rapid digitalization, and supportive regulations are fueling unprecedented development across the region. At the same time, construction of data centers in MENAT presents major challenges, including complex permitting processes, inflationary pressure, geotechnical limits, workforce shortages, and supply chain constraints. These issues affect both new construction data centers and expansions of existing sites.
